Warehouse District Mixed-Use Infill
Over recent years, old abandoned storage shelters have been rejuvinated into residential lofts in this sub-section of the Central Business District. The area now hosts an abundant amount of hip restaurants, music clubs, and galleries.The site is 21’6” wide by 115’ long, lies between two delapidated shed-like structures, and has access from two parallel streets (South Diamond on the North/Andrew Higgins on the South). The program consists of a Fitness Center on theGround Level and two residences (a Rental Unit [2bd/2ba] & Owners Unit (3bd/2.5ba) on the Upper Floors. The GreenParti-Walls tie in the adjacent green spaces of the neighborhood, contrast with the present rustic nature of surrounding buildings, serve as a focal point for residents along with the community, and define the outdoor circulation corridor.
